From Swedish Beauty Queen to Glamour Model and Devoted Mother

Picture this: a peaceful town in southern Sweden where the streets are calm, the air feels crisp, and life moves at a slower rhythm. That’s where Sandra Nilsson’s story begins. Born on February 17, 1986, in Ystad and raised in the cozy community of Sjöbo, Sandra grew up surrounded by simplicity. Just a few traffic lights. Familiar faces everywhere. The kind of place where everyone knows your name.

But sometimes, the most extraordinary journeys begin in the most ordinary places. Sandra’s early years were grounded and family-centered. There were no flashing cameras or red carpets—just school, friends, and dreams quietly forming beneath the surface.

Then, at 14, everything shifted.

A Chance Encounter in Paris That Changed Everything

During a family trip to Paris, Sandra caught the attention of a modeling scout. One moment she was a teenager sightseeing with her parents. The next, she was being told she had the potential to model internationally.

Yet her parents encouraged caution. Education came first. Sandra listened. She completed her studies and earned qualifications in nursing and childcare. That decision says a lot about her character. She wasn’t chasing fame recklessly—she was building a foundation.

Still, the camera’s pull was strong. By 16, she signed with a Swedish modeling agency, stepping into a world far removed from her quiet hometown. The runway lights replaced streetlamps. The stage was set.

Early Modeling Success and Pageant Triumphs

Sandra approached modeling with focus and natural elegance. She worked with leading Swedish brands, appearing in campaigns and on runways that highlighted her fresh, radiant look. Her confidence grew with every shoot.

Then came beauty competitions.

She earned titles such as Miss Salming, Miss World Bikini Model, and Miss Hawaiian Tropic Sweden. Each win acted like a stepping stone, lifting her profile beyond Sweden’s borders. International campaigns followed. Calendar features. Television appearances, including spots on the Travel Channel.

By her late teens, Sandra had become a rising name in Scandinavian fashion circles. Fluent in Swedish, Danish, and English, she moved effortlessly between cultures. In 2006, she was voted one of Sweden’s most captivating women, cementing her status as a standout presence.

Global Exposure: Hawaiian Tropic and International Recognition

Sandra’s career truly accelerated when she began representing Hawaiian Tropic internationally. Suddenly, her image appeared on billboards and in magazines across multiple countries. Commercials showcased her sun-kissed glow and effortless charm.

To expand her opportunities, she relocated to New York City. That move wasn’t just geographical—it was symbolic. She left behind small-town familiarity for the fast pace of one of the world’s most competitive industries.

New York teaches resilience quickly. Sandra embraced the hustle, refined her English, and adapted to a global stage. Appearances on programs like Sweden’s Next Top Model kept her visible back home while her international profile expanded.

A Career-Defining Moment in 2008

In 2008, at just 21 years old, Sandra achieved a major milestone. She became the featured model for a prominent January magazine issue—the first Swedish woman in a decade to receive that distinction.

Spotted at a film festival, she was flown to Los Angeles for the shoot. Imagine the whirlwind: new city, high-profile production, immense expectations. Excitement and nerves likely walked hand in hand.

Love, Partnership, and a New Chapter with Roberto Cavalli

Around 2014, Sandra began a relationship with Italian fashion designer Roberto Cavalli. Their partnership attracted attention, particularly because of the age difference. But public commentary never seemed to rattle her.

Together, they traveled between Italy, New York, and Sweden. In 2015, Cavalli gifted her a private island near Stockholm—an extraordinary retreat rich with history and natural beauty. It was more than a romantic gesture. It symbolized shared dreams and a life built beyond headlines.

In March 2023, they welcomed a son, Giorgio. Motherhood transformed Sandra’s priorities. The runway faded into the background. Family took center stage.

Following Cavalli’s passing in 2024, Sandra stepped into a new role: single mother. That shift required strength, grace, and resilience. She continues to honor shared memories while building a stable, loving environment for her son.

Stepping Away from the Spotlight

As of late 2025, Sandra lives a more private life. She has largely stepped back from public modeling and red carpet appearances. Instead, she focuses on family, personal well-being, and meaningful causes.

She supports charitable initiatives, particularly those benefiting children. Her vegetarian lifestyle and love of nature reflect her grounded personality. She splits her time between Sweden and, possibly, Italy—embracing tranquility over flash.
